Search Engine Optimization (SEO) is a vital skill for anyone looking to enhance their online presence. Whether you are a business owner, marketer, or aspiring SEO professional, understanding SEO can set you apart in a competitive landscape. In this guide, we will explore the key steps to becoming an expert in SEO, including foundational knowledge, practical skills, and advanced techniques.
Understanding the Basics of SEO
Before diving into advanced strategies, it's crucial to grasp the fundamentals of SEO, including:
- What is SEO? SEO is the process of optimizing a website to improve its visibility in search engines like Google.
- Why SEO Matters: Higher visibility leads to increased traffic, which can translate into more sales or conversions.
- Key SEO Components: Familiarize yourself with on-page SEO, off-page SEO, and technical SEO.
1. Develop Your SEO Knowledge
Start by educating yourself with these essential resources:
- Online Courses: Platforms like Moz, HubSpot, and Google offer comprehensive SEO courses.
- Books: Read SEO-focused books such as 'The Art of SEO' for in-depth knowledge.
- Blogs and Podcasts: Follow industry-leading blogs and podcasts to stay updated on trends.
2. Master Keyword Research
Keyword research is the backbone of SEO. To become an expert:
- Use Tools: Utilize tools like Google Keyword Planner and SEMrush for effective keyword analysis.
- Understand User Intent: Focus on keywords that align with what your target audience is searching for.
- Long-Tail Keywords: Target long-tail keywords for lower competition and higher conversion rates.
3. Optimize On-Page Elements
On-page SEO involves optimizing individual pages to rank higher:
- Title Tags and Meta Descriptions: Craft compelling title tags and meta descriptions for better click-through rates.
- Content Quality: Ensure that your content is relevant, high-quality, and keyword-rich.
- URLs: Create SEO-friendly URLs by including keywords and keeping them concise.
4. Build Quality Backlinks
Off-page SEO is essential for establishing authority:
- Guest Blogging: Write guest posts on reputable websites to earn backlinks.
- Social Media: Leverage social media to promote your content and attract links.
- Networking: Connect with other bloggers and marketers to enhance your link-building opportunities.
5. Dive into Technical SEO
Technical SEO ensures that your website is crawlable and user-friendly:
- Site Speed: Improve load times with caching and image optimization.
- Mobile-Friendliness: Ensure your website is responsive and works well on mobile devices.
- Sitemap and Robots.txt: Create and submit sitemaps to help search engines understand your site structure.
6. Analyze and Adjust
Regularly measure your SEO performance:
- Use Analytics Tools: Utilize Google Analytics and Google Search Console to track your traffic and rankings.
- Set KPIs: Define key performance indicators to measure success.
- Continuous Improvement: Be prepared to adjust your strategies based on performance data.
Conclusion
Becoming an expert in SEO requires a blend of knowledge, practical skills, and ongoing learning. By mastering the fundamentals, conducting thorough research, optimizing your website, and analyzing results, you will set yourself on the path to SEO mastery. At Prebo Digital, we believe in empowering individuals and businesses through effective SEO strategies for higher search rankings and increased traffic. Get in touch with us today to elevate your SEO skills!